Company Info
Concur Technologies, Inc. was founded in 1993 to automate costly and inefficient business processes across the enterprise.

Concur was the first in the world to offer an enterprise software product for automating travel and entertainment (T&E) expense reporting within an open technology framework. Today, Concur's workplace eCommerce solutions?business-to-business procurement, human resources self-service, travel booking, and T&E expense management?are the most widely used solutions for automating business-to-business eCommerce and workplace business processes over the corporate Intranet and public Internet. Concur's workplace eCommerce solutions are used by more than 2.4 million employees in more than 320 companies worldwide.
